The Sous Chef role at Flik Hospitality Group represents an exciting opportunity for an energetic and entrepreneurial culinary professional seeking to contribute to an esteemed hospitality organization. As a vital part of the Culinary Department, the Sous Chef assists in managing the successful operation of all culinary activities within the facility. Responsibilities include supervising kitchen staff, preparing and cooking diverse food items, and collaborating with the Executive Chef in developing new, innovative menus that meet high-quality standards and customer preferences.
In addition to hands-on food preparation, the Sous Chef supports cost control measures to optimize operational efficiency and participates in ordering supplies. This role requires proactive involvement in rolling out new culinary programs aligned with the company’s marketing and culinary strategies and producing exceptional catering events that enhance customer satisfaction. Working closely with both team members and leadership, the Sous Chef must ensure strict adherence to food safety, sanitation protocols, and presentation standards.
Ideal candidates possess a strong culinary background through an associate degree or equivalent experience and demonstrate progressive kitchen management skills. Experience in high-volume, complex foodservice operations, including catering and institutional cooking, is highly valued. Proficiency with computers, including Microsoft Office applications and email communication, is essential. ServSafe certification is preferred, along with a readiness to engage in client satisfaction initiatives.
